hehe I dont get any range.... About 200 to 500 feet..
 
what FM are you using?

best ones are the landmark fm350, the decade ms100, or the latest broadcast vision transmitters.

i had a BV and it covered a 3 floor 36 unit reinforced brick and concrete apartment building inside and out and put a decent signal over the outdoors of entire property.

those little BV's push the absolute limits of 15.239.

i was using a pretty sensitive communications receiver. a typical low sensitivity/selectivity boombox covered some of the interior of building and approximately 75ft outdoors.
